Seabourn Bound For Europe In 2023 With A Wealth Of Ultra-Luxury Voyages Visiting Nearly 170 Destinations

SEATTLE, July 20, 2021Seabourn, the ultra-luxury cruise line, is already looking ahead to summer in Europe in 2023, announcing itineraries for four Seabourn ships set to explore the continent that fills many travel bucket lists from late March to early December. The line’s 2023 Europe season opens for sale on July 21, 2021, and full itineraries and details are available on its website.

First-time and returning Seabourn guests have much to consider and ultimately to choose from throughout Europe, with a wealth of handcrafted itineraries mixing favorite cities and lesser-visited ports, including several new and/or notable destinations. Four of Seabourn’s ultra-luxury ships will explore Europe with elegance and ease, including Seabourn Encore, Seabourn Quest, Seabourn Ovation and Seabourn Sojourn. Together, the fleet will offer 194 individual departures from a variety of different embarkation gateways. The season will include cruises of seven to 38 days around Europe, visiting nearly 170 different destinations. The ships will sail the Mediterranean from the Canary Islands and Morocco, through Iberia and Italy to the Adriatic, and Croatia, Greece and Turkey. Travelers can also explore Northern Europe, visiting shining cities, picturesque villages and stunning sights of Scandinavia and Russia, the Norwegian fjords, scenic British Isles, and Greenland and Iceland.

Seabourn strives to fill its itineraries with the most interesting ports of call, and its 2023 Europe season will feature 16 “new and notable” destinations the line either hasn’t previously visited or hasn’t been to in years. They include Marbella and Alicante, Spain; Agadir, Morocco; Penzance, United Kingdom; Marmaris, Turkey; Livadi, Naousa, Kavala (Neapolis), Milos, and Poros, Greece; Ystad, Sweden; Gdansk, Poland, Port Pionersky (Kaliningrad), Russia; Riga, Latvia; Rønne, Bornholm, Denmark; and Hamilton, Bermuda.

Here is what to look forward to from each of the Seabourn ultra-luxury ships that will be bound for Europe in 2023:

  • Seabourn Sojourn’s Europe season is scheduled from May 27 to November 3, 2023, with a new focus on 10-day voyages throughout the Western Mediterranean, offering more in-depth experiences and reaching smaller destinations. Highlights include The Rivieras with itineraries between Monte Carlo and Barcelona, as well as off-the-beaten-track destinations such as Sanary Sur Mer, St. Raphael, Golfo Aranci and La Ciotat. Seabourn Sojourn’s round-trip itineraries between Spain and Morocco will include evenings in Casablanca and Tangier, as well as late nights in Malaga. The 10-day voyages from Barcelona to Rome will sail east to Malta and Gozo, with the latter as an exclusive stopping point as Seabourn is one of the few cruise lines to venture to the site of the Ggantija Temples, one of the world’s oldest free-standing structures. Seabourn Sojourn will offer 43 itineraries, ranging from 10-day cruises to 30-day combinations, among them the 10-day Romance on the Riviera, 20-day France, Italy & Maltese Gems, and 30-day Best of the Mediterranean.

  • Seabourn Encore will explore the Eastern Mediterranean from April 23 to November 19, 2023, with seven-day voyages of the Greek Isles norwaand Turkish coast providing numerous departures through twin itineraries that invite combinations with Mykonos and Ephesus in one direction, and Santorini and Bodrum in the other. New highlights include an extra pair of Holy Land sailings, an enhanced itinerary from Athens to Haifa visiting ports such as Antalya and Alanya on the South coast of Turkey, and two additional 10-day voyages round-trip from Athens, with mid-cruise overnights in Istanbul. There will also be 11-day voyages round-trip from Athens to take guests to Malta, Italy and Turkey. Taken together, Seabourn Encore will offer 78 itineraries ranging from 7-day cruises, which can also be combined to create 14- and 21-day adventures, with highlights including the 7-day Greek & Dalmatian Delights, 14-day Aegean Marvels, and the 21-day Mediterranean Mysteries & the Holy Land.

  • Seabourn Quest will explore the Western Mediterranean in 2023, with its season running from March 26 to July 31. The ship will focus on 10- and 11-day itineraries, providing in-depth explorations of the Adriatic. Among new itineraries are 10-day voyages round-trip from Venice that will reach as far south as Corfu, Parga and Zakinthos; and 11-day voyages round-trip from Venice that will reach Malta and Syracusa with a berth in the heart of the city. Also, Seabourn will be the only line heading to the nearby super-yacht port of Tivat, Montenegro. Seabourn Quest finishes its Europe season with a 24-day Route of the Vikings, from Dover to Montreal exploring the British Isles, Iceland, Greenland, and the Canadian provinces of Newfoundland and Quebec, with exciting Ventures by Seabourn offerings along the way. Altogether, Seabourn Quest will offer 24 itineraries ranging from 7-day voyages to combination cruises up to 38 days, including the 7-day Riviera Escapades, the 21-day Jewels of the Venetian Empire, the 24-day Route of the Vikings, and the 36-day New World Exploration II.

  • Seabourn Ovation will cruise Northern Europe and the Western Mediterranean from April 9 to November 19, 2023. New 10- and 11-day itineraries from London to Stockholm and back will visit a number of ports Seabourn has not explored in years, including Skagen, Denmark; Ystad, Sweden; Gdansk, Poland; and Kaliningrad, Russia – the last, a true maiden call. The itinerary will also offer a late night in Hamburg and a full transit call in Copenhagen staying into the evening. There will also be the line’s popular 7-day Baltic and St. Petersburg voyages between Copenhagen and Stockholm, as well as 14-day Norway and North Cape itineraries where Seabourn truly shines by cruising the inside passage, highly scenic routes. Seabourn Ovation will offer a total of 49 itineraries through the season, ranging from seven days to combinations up to 28 days, including 7-day The Baltic & St. Petersburg, 10-day Scandinavian Snapshot, and 21-day Mediterranean and Iberian Tapestry.

Optional Ventures by Seabourn expedition-style excursions will highlight three North Cape & Majestic Fjords cruises on Seabourn Ovation and the Route of the Vikings cruise on Seabourn Quest. Highlights of the former within Norway include exploring the Aurlandsfjord and its surrounding islands via kayak; visiting the Arctic Alpine Botanic Garden in Tromso; and exploring Nordfjord by Zodiac with a cable car ride to the viewpoint at Hoven Loen. For the latter, there will be a Zodiac tour of Heimaey Island in Iceland; a Zodiac transfer followed by a walking tour of the Hvalsey Norse Ruins in Qaqortoq (Julianehab), Greenland; and a Calve Island kayak tour in Tobermory, Isle of Mull, Scotland…to name a few.
